First off you have a CRIME FREE /Drug Free addendum on each tenant that lives in your rental.If you notice suspicious activity or have reports of the same you give tenant notice of high traffic / volume of people to unit as notice to cure.. if this continues or you see or smell drugs you give notice of non-compliance and lease termination. yes you can ask police for advise.. but your main goal is to limit the calls police have to make to your property so you don't want to be listed as a nuisance property. but if the issues warrants it yes call the cops and if a neighboring unit is worried tell them to call the cops sometimes you have to have a record of police calls to verify the issue so you can write up infraction for eviction action..
